1. Halotherapy Sauna
Halotherapy, (salt therapy), involves breathing in microscopic salt particles in a controlled environment to reduce inflammation, decrease mucus, and kill bacteria in the respiratory tract. It is used to ease symptoms of asthma, bronchitis, COPD, and allergies, while also improving skin conditions like eczema and psoriasis.
Some key benefits are:
Respiratory Relief: The anti-inflammatory, antibacterial, and antimicrobial properties of salt can reduce inflammation in airways, open breathing passages, and increase oxygen intake. It helps relieve symptoms of asthma, chronic bronchitis, COPD, sinusitis, and smoker's cough.
Skin Improvement: Salt particles pe*****te deep into the skin's surface, helping to reduce eczema, psoriasis, acne, dermatitis, and signs of aging. It also provides natural exfoliation.
Immune System Support: The dry salt acts as an antibacterial agent, which may help cleanse the respiratory system of bacteria, pollutants, and allergens.
Relaxation and Stress Reduction: Salt rooms create a quiet, tranquil environment that can help decrease stress, calm the nervous system, and improve overall wellness.
2. Red light therapy bed
Red light therapy (RLT) beds are full-body, non-invasive, tanning-bed-style devices using red and near-infrared LED light to boost cellular energy (ATP), reduce inflammation, and enhance recovery.
How They Work: Using photobiomodulation, RLT beds emit specific wavelengths (630nm–950nm) that pe*****te the skin, accelerating collagen production and repairing tissues.
Benefits: Used by athletes and clinics to treat pain, inflammation, eczema, and skin conditions while boosting cellular energy.
Treatment Duration: The recommended usage for maximum, lasting results is typically 15–20 minutes per session, often 3–4 times a week.
